In this eye-opening episode of the Behavioral Health Integration podcast, host Jacob Minnig welcomes special guests Michael Thornhill and Richard O'Bannon to explore how these substances can be transformative for mental health and addiction treatment. Whether you're skeptical or curious, this conversation promises to challenge your perceptions and maybe even inspire a new way of thinking about healing.
Michael and Richard dive into the intricate relationship between psychedelics and our mind, body, and spirit. They emphasize the importance of 'set and setting'—the mental and physical environment in which psychedelic experiences occur. This isn't just about popping a pill; it's about creating a safe, supportive space for profound personal insights. The episode also delves into their work with indigenous communities, shedding light on the sacred reciprocity between these ancient traditions and modern Western practices.
You'll hear about different models of psychedelic therapy, including the use of mushrooms, and why due diligence is crucial in these spaces. One of the standout moments comes when Michael Thornhill explains, 'Psychedelic substances open up a realm that is not necessarily viewed on the outside.
It's not for everybody, but it enables you to have a direct experience of something that is not available in day-to-day life.' This episode isn't just an academic discussion; it's a heartfelt exploration of how psychedelics can offer new avenues for healing trauma and mental health disorders.
